尝试连接Oracle数据库用c语言来实现(c 试图 连oracle)

尝试连接Oracle数据库:用c语言来实现

在当今数据处理的世界中,数据库是不可或缺的一部分。Oracle数据库是最流行的数据库之一,具有广泛的应用性和广泛的支持。使用c语言来与Oracle数据库进行交互是一项非常有用和有趣的任务。本文旨在介绍如何使用c语言连接Oracle数据库。

我们需要下载适当的库来连接Oracle数据库。Oracle客户端提供了库,包括Oracle Instant Client,它可以在不安装完整Oracle数据库的情况下访问Oracle数据库。安装后,我们需要在链接器中添加库的路径,以便可以在程序中使用。在添加路径之后,使用Oracle库函数进行连接。

以下代码段说明了如何连接Oracle数据库:

“`c

#include

#include

#include

#include

#include

using namespace std;

int mn()

{

Environment* env = nullptr;

Connection* conn = nullptr;

env = Environment::createEnvironment(Environment::DEFAULT);

conn = env->createConnection(“oracle_user”, “oracle_password”, “oracle_connection_string”);

cout

conn->terminateConnection();

Environment::terminateEnvironment(env);

getch();

return 0;

}

“`

在上面的代码段中,我们使用OCCI库功能和标准C++库来连接到Oracle数据库。在此之前,我们需要在环境中设置一个environment(环境),然后从环境中创建连接。创建连接的参数包括用户名、密码和连接字符串。

在创建连接后,我们输出一条消息以确认成功连接到Oracle数据库。如果连接失败,会抛出一个异常并终止程序。

代码段使用terminateConnection()函数在关闭连接之前终止连接。使用terminateEnvironment()函数在关闭环境之前终止环境。

总结

本文介绍了如何使用c语言连接Oracle数据库。我们需要下载适当的库,设置库的路径,然后使用Oracle库函数进行连接。连接成功后,可以使用各种功能来处理和操作Oracle数据库中的数据。

连接Oracle数据库是一项有用的任务,也是一项使程序员兴奋和挑战的任务。通过使用适当的库和函数,我们可以轻松地连接到Oracle数据库并实现我们所需的功能。


数据运维技术 » 尝试连接Oracle数据库用c语言来实现(c 试图 连oracle)